It seems I've somehow broken ZC. As soon as it starts, the only direction key I can use on the quest selection screen is "up". The others don't work. This means I can't browse through quest saves that are beyond the first page. Then upon loading one of the first page quests, the "down" and "right" direction keys are permanently stuck (Link keeps automatically going down and right).

 

My keyboard appears to be fine, I can use the stuck direction keys normally in Windows and other programs. 

 

I've even freshly reinstalled the latest version of ZC (although I've kept my zc.sav file, but I've overwritten every existing file when a newer one existed in the latest version), and this didn't solve the problem.

 

Can anybody help me with this strange issue?

There's probably some input device or sensor registering as a controller that shouldn't be. Try setting joystick_index in ag.cfg to another number.

Hard to say what caused it. Maybe an OS update changed a driver, or maybe some other application enabled a previously disabled device. If you look in the device manager, you might be able to figure out what device it is, but that probably won't help elucidate the cause.
